A Finite Difference Time Domain (FDTD) code has been developed to model a cellular phone radiating in the presence of a human head. In order to implement the code, FDTD difference equations have been solved in a computational domain truncated by a Perfectly Matched Layer (PML). Specific Absorption Rate (SAR) calculations have been carried out to study safety issues in mobile communication.eninfo:eu-repo/semantics/closedAccessEvaluation of Specific Absorption Rate distribution in a human head using Finite Difference Time Domain methodConference Object348345
